    Lucky Lager Western Town Advertisement. Very cool advertisement constructed of molded plastic showing typical scene of a Western town, complete with bank, barber shop, general store, jail, stage depot, and saloon. Manufactured by General Brewing Company. I believe these were made in the 1960's, but am not really sure of the date. As with any of the molded plastic signs, there is some slight cracking, but the colors are very vibrant and the subject matter is AWESOME. Lucky Lager was one of the most popular beers in the Western United States and this advertisement fits right in. "Lucky Lager-The brand that's best...favorite in the West."
